Questions about Crown Pointe
What ongoing training does the staff receive in dementia care?
Monthly in services and training
Describe the overall population of assisted living residents at Crown Pointe. What is their average age? What are their favorite things to do?
The average age is 80 years old. We are a very social community! Residents love all things education including weekly podcasts and an active book club. We have a gorgeous chapel with Catholic and non denominational services. Go to the grocery store and retail store every week!
What programs or activities does Crown Pointe offer to enrich residents' well-being?
An abundance of activities to include morning exercise group, grief counseling, manicures, bingo, tai chi, therapeutic coloring, wii bowling, husker tailgates, live entertainment, holiday parties, bridge and card groups, catholic communion, mass and rosary, live animals, bible study, movie night, monthly movies at Aksarben theater, coffee and cookies and more!
What places are near Crown Pointe or within walking distance for assisted living residents to enjoy?
Aksarben Village, Hy-Vee, the interstate is very close
What transportation services does Crown Pointe offer to assisted living residents?
Unlimited transportation to doctor visits. Weekly store trips and outings
What makes the chef or dining program at Crown Pointe exceptional? What kind of menu can assisted living residents expect?
Restaurant style dining to include a featured dish at breakfast, noon and the evening meal. Outside of the feature, a full 3 page, always available, menu with gluten free options notated
What safety features or security measures does Crown Pointe offer to assisted living residents?
Pendant, monthly fire and tornado drills. Community locks at sunset and unlocks at sunrise. Monitored video cameras around community with 24 concierge service.
How does Crown Pointe keep residents' families informed about their loved ones?
Life loop, emails and resident council meetings. Care plans.
What is the care staff-to-resident ratio at Crown Pointe during daytime and nighttime hours?
14:1
If Crown Pointe accepts dogs or cats, what indoor/outdoor areas can they enjoy?
We do accept dogs and cats. We have a lovely walking path around the community with ample green space

Does Crown Pointe work with an agency or registry to provide nursing and medical assistance as needed?
Yes!
How many staffers are on duty in the daytime and overnight?
3
What safety features or security measures does Crown Pointe provide to protect residents who wander?
Wander gaurds. 24 hour concierge at front desk
What programs or activities does Crown Pointe offer to keep residents engaged? How does the staff engage residents' long-term memories?
Lifestyle stations. Full time activity director for Independent Living residents and Assisted Living residents, as well as in our memory care community. Gorgeous secure outdoor patio with space to garden and grow food
Who assesses residents' health and cognitive functioning? How often is that assessment repeated?
Our Director of Nursing. Upon admission and every quarter.
What techniques does Crown Pointe use to support memory care residents during mealtimes?
Aromatherapy with warm towels for hands to stimulate hunger and a relaxed environment
How does Crown Pointe keep residents' families informed about their loved ones' health?
Life loop, emails
Describe the neighborhood around Crown Pointe. Is it located in a residential neighborhood, a business district, a rural setting, or other type of locale?
Located in an established neighborhood in central Omaha. Huge trees and quiet. Close by school and church
Is Crown Pointe affiliated with a hospital if more care is needed?
We are not.
